First, first understand the principle: Why do you have to FM pairing?
Wired microphones rely on lines to transmit signals, and can be used stably when plugged in; The wireless microphone belongs to two-way radio frequency communication equipment,
The receiver and transmitter must lock the same set of frequency points.
In order to transmit sound normally.
In daily use, switching on and off the device, changing the use environment, peripheral Bluetooth /WiFi interference, device restart and voltage fluctuation will all cause frequency shift and pairing cache failure. This is also the core reason why the microphone turned on normally, but suddenly lost its voice and the noise surged. Simply put:
Pairing is not right, even the best microphone can't receive the radio normally.
Second, automatic infrared frequency matching for the whole network (95% home/live broadcast microphone adaptation)
At present, most of the collar-clip wheat, hand-held wireless wheat and live wireless wheat on the market support infrared one-button frequency matching, which is simple to operate and has the highest success rate. It is also the official standard pairing method.
Complete standard operating procedures:
1. Power failure restart initialization
: The receiver and microphone transmitter are all turned off, let stand for 3 seconds, and completely empty the old frequency cache to avoid historical data interfering with the new pairing.
2. Turn on the receiver first
: Turn on the power of the receiver, wait for the screen to light up and the self-check of the equipment to be completed, and keep the standby state.
3. Enter the exclusive frequency mode.
: Press the SET/SYNC/ frequency key on the receiver for a short time or a long time, and a flashing horizontal line, PAIRING logo or infrared icon will appear on the screen, thus successfully entering the pairing state.
4. Infrared precise alignment
Turn on the power supply of the microphone transmitter, find the infrared sensing window marked with IR on the fuselage, aim at the infrared area of the receiver vertically, keep a distance of 3-5cm, and do not tilt or block the sensing port.
5. Wait for automatic synchronization to complete.
: Let it stand for 2-5 seconds, the screen frequency number is fixed, the indicator light changes from flashing to constant light, and there is no error prompt, that is, the pairing is successful and the radio can be used normally.
Key points for attention
Strong light and direct sunlight will interfere with infrared signals, so it is recommended to operate in indoor soft light environment to greatly reduce the probability of pairing failure.
Third, manual FM course (required for professional UHF microphone/multi-equipment live broadcast room)
Professional microphones without infrared frequency matching function, or scenes where multiple sets of microphones are used at the same time and cross-talk interference frequently occurs, must be manually tuned to lock clean frequency points, so as to eliminate equipment interference from the root.
Detailed steps of manual frequency modulation:
1. After the device is turned on, observe the receiver screen, and manually switch the channel and the corresponding frequency through the CH/FREQ/ addition and subtraction buttons.
2. Give priority to blank, clean frequency points without interference, and actively avoid the interference frequency bands of surrounding WiFi, Bluetooth and electronic equipment.
3. After fixing the frequency point of the receiver, adjust the frequency of the microphone transmitter synchronously,
Ensure that the frequency figures at both ends of the transceiver are completely consistent.
.
4. After the frequency matching is completed, press and hold the channel key to turn on the LOCK frequency locking function to prevent frequency hopping and disconnection caused by accidental touch.
Practical core skills
: single set of equipment is used, and automatic frequency alignment is completely sufficient;
Two or more wireless microphones work at the same time, and the frequency points must be staggered manually.
The frequency band interval of each set of equipment is more than 5MHz, which completely solves the problems of crosstalk, crosstalk and signal interference.
Fourth, the practical method of simultaneous pairing of multiple microphones without conflict
In live broadcast rooms, conference rooms, multi-person interviews and other scenes, when multiple sets of wireless microphones are working at the same time, the problems of frequency scrambling, crosstalk, silence and jamming are most likely to occur. The correct step-by-step operation method is as follows:
1. All microphones and receivers should be turned off, and the standby cache of the equipment should be emptied to avoid the conflict of starting and scrambling for frequency.
2. The first set of equipment is turned on separately, and the automatic frequency matching or manual frequency modulation is completed. After locking the frequency point, it is allowed to stand for use.
3. Turn on the second set and the third set of equipment in turn, and each set of equipment will be replaced with a brand-new blank frequency point and paired separately.
4. After all devices are paired, turn on the frequency locking function to prevent signal interference caused by automatic frequency hopping of devices.
Fifth, the pairing failed, can't match the frequency? 6 reasons+accurate solutions
The vast majority of pairing failures are not equipment hardware failures, but errors in operation details, which can be quickly repaired by targeted investigation:
1. The equipment is low in power.
: When the microphone and receiver are low-powered, the intensity of the transmitted signal is attenuated, so it is impossible to complete synchronous pairing. Before pairing, it is necessary to ensure that the equipment has sufficient power.
2. Infrared occlusion, angle offset
: fuselage film, dust and inclined plane alignment will block the infrared transmission signal, which can be solved by wiping the sensing window and vertical alignment.
3. Strong light interference
: Sunlight and high-power light direct at the infrared window, which will lead to synchronization failure. Just change the cool and soft light environment and re-pair.
4. Peripheral radio frequency interference
: Routers, Bluetooth devices, chargers, and computer hosts are clustered in close proximity, which will interfere with frequency band signals. When pairing, it is necessary to stay away from all kinds of electronic interference sources.
5. Old frequency buffer residue
: The device remains historical pairing data, which will lead to the failure of new pairing. All transceiver devices will be shut down and restarted, and the cache will be cleared before operation.
6. Frequency not unlocked.
: Some professional microphones have their own frequency locking function, so they need to be switched to the UNLOCK state before they can be tuned and paired normally.
6. There is still noise and disconnection after successful pairing. Ultimate optimization scheme
1. After successful pairing, avoid frequent switching on and off and repeated frequency alignment. Excessive operation will easily lead to disorder of equipment frequency points and unstable signals.
2. The receiver should be placed in a high place with no shielding as far as possible, away from metal equipment, computer mainframe and power adapter, so as to reduce signal shielding and attenuation.
3. In noisy environment and multi-equipment working scene, priority should be given to manually fixing frequency points, and the functions of automatic frequency sweeping and automatic frequency hopping of equipment should be turned off to ensure the continuous stability of signals.
4. When the equipment is used for a long time, the signal attenuation and sound quality become worse, and the signal link can be refreshed again to restore the best radio state quickly.
